Accountabilities: As the Salesforce Ecosystem Development Manager, you will be responsible for expanding ecosystem relationships, generating new business opportunities, and strengthening market presence. You will combine partnership development, business development, and industry engagement to create meaningful connections and support revenue growth.

  • Build and manage relationships with Salesforce Account Executives, Solution Engineers, Partner Managers, and ecosystem stakeholders through consistent engagement.
  • Maintain an active presence within the Salesforce community through office visits, partner events, networking opportunities, and industry gatherings.
  • Identify and pursue target accounts aligned with financial services priorities, including Capital Markets, Wealth Management, Asset Management, Private Equity, and related sectors.
  • Generate qualified introductions and meetings through outbound outreach, networking, and partner collaboration.
  • Educate ecosystem partners on service capabilities, industry expertise, customer success stories, and key differentiators.
  • Create ongoing engagement opportunities through market insights, relevant content, client examples, and strategic follow-up.
  • Support opportunity development from initial conversations through qualification and transition to leadership and delivery teams.
  • Maintain accurate CRM records tracking partner relationships, referrals, activities, and pipeline progress.
  • Collaborate with leadership to refine messaging, positioning, and ecosystem engagement strategies.
  • Provide market intelligence on customer needs, partner priorities, competitive trends, and emerging opportunities.
  • Ensure effective handoffs between business development, leadership, and delivery teams as opportunities progress.
  • Contribute ideas and initiatives that strengthen ecosystem presence and long-term commercial growth.

Requirements:

The ideal candidate is a proactive business development professional with Salesforce ecosystem experience, strong relationship-building abilities, and familiarity with financial services organizations. You should be comfortable operating independently, creating new connections, and developing opportunities in a rapidly evolving environment.

  • 3–6 years of experience in business development, partner development, sales, consulting, customer success, recruiting, or another relationship-focused commercial role.
  • Previous experience working within the Salesforce ecosystem, such as with Salesforce, a consulting partner, technology partner, or a role involving collaboration with Salesforce teams.
  • Understanding of how Salesforce Account Executives, Solution Engineers, Partner Managers, and consulting partners collaborate to support customer opportunities.
  • Experience supporting financial services industries, ideally including Capital Markets, Wealth Management, Asset Management, Private Equity, Banking, or Fintech.
  • Familiarity with Salesforce solutions used by financial services organizations, including Financial Services Cloud.
  • Demonstrated ability to build professional relationships, generate meetings, and create opportunities through networking and targeted outreach.
  • Strong organizational skills with excellent follow-through and CRM management discipline.
  • Ability to work independently, prioritize effectively, and adapt within a growing organization.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to engage executives, partners, clients, and internal stakeholders.
  • Curiosity, persistence, and willingness to continuously learn and refine strategies.
  • Ability to regularly engage in person within the New York metropolitan area.
  • Must be authorized to work in the United States.
